Court rejects bail application of accused facing trial in Dogra’s murder case
3/25/2009 11:13:20 PM

Early Times Report

Jammu, Mar 25- The 2nd Additional Sessions Judge Jammu, Vinod Chatterji Koul rejected the bail application of Labha Ram, one of the accused, facing trial in a murder case of Ajit Singh Dogra Deputy Advocate General who was murdered on January 10, 2008.
Court, after hearing Advocate OP Sharma appearing for the accused and Special Public Prosecutor RK Kotwal appearing for the state, observed that Special Public Prosecutor has objected the grant of bail on the ground that accused cannot be released on bail as he is involved along with other accused in a murder case in which charges have been framed. Court after considering the case of the accused dismissed the bail application filed by the accused for releasing him on interim bail.
It is worthwhile to mention here deceased Ajit Singh Dogra Deputy Advocate General was stooped on January 10, 2008 by the accused persons and started firing and thereafter attacked with sharp edged weapon with intention to kill the Ajit Singh Dogra. The deceased in a serious condition was admitted in the GMC Jammu and later on shifted to Delhi where he died. A case u/s 302/341/147/149/34 RPC r/w section 4/25 Arms Act was registered against accused persons namely Vishal Sharma alias Vishu, Ashok Kumar alias Shoka, Amrish Khjauria alias Max, Labha Ram alias Sanjay, Raj Kumar alias Raju, Gourav Sharma alias Dana and Mohan Singh alias Mona and after completion of the investigation challan was presented in the Court of law.
